Item # 3140 RTV Coating, Silicone Dow Electronics Conformal Coatings


1-part, translucent coating; good flowability; good flame resistance; UL, IPC, and Mil Spec approved/recognized

Features

Good flowability; room-temperature cure; no added solvents; UV indicator for inspection; UL 94V-1 recognized, IPC-CC-830, and MIL-A-46146



Potential Uses

Supplied at a higher viscosity, this material cures to a tough, durable elastomer for improved pin/solder joint coverage and thin-section encapsulation.



Application Methods

Applied by brush or flow coating or syringe dispensed for spot protection of pins or other devices.



Cure

Time to cure is dependent on several variables including the method of application, film thickness, temperature and humidity. Tack- free time in the data table gives an indication of typical times until surface is dry enough to handle. Cure time for full cure are indications of time needed to develop full physical properties such as durometer, tensile strength or adhesion. These times, including full cure time, can be significantly improved by introducing mild heat of 60 °C or less.
